L-Carnitine (injectable)
SummaryMitochondrial fat-shuttle cofactor — used for endurance support and recomposition protocols.
MechanismShuttles long-chain fatty acids across the inner mitochondrial membrane for β-oxidation. Injectable form bypasses oral absorption ceiling.

SafetyGenerally safe. High doses can cause fishy body odor (TMAO production) and mild GI upset.
